Senior Mechanical HVAC Engineer

Company Description

Senior Mechanical-HVAC Engineer in the Advanced Manufacturing Division of Ramboll.

Ramboll is actively seeking a Mechanical Engineer in our Binghamton, NY office. The selected candidate for this position will be expected to work across a wide range of mechanical engineering knowledge areas and have a desired focus area in heating, ventilation, and air conditioning related work.  The successful candidate will be responsible for, but not limited to, the following:

  • Performing design and engineering work in various areas of the mechanical discipline.  The majority of the work will be related to heating, ventilation and Air Conditioning (HVAC); however, the candidate should also expect work in industrial piping, plumbing, central utility plants, compressed air systems, chilled water systems, steam systems, and fire protection.
  • Coordinating with other engineering disciplines to produce final construction drawings and details associated with mechanical engineering projects.
  • Developing conceptual designs and cost estimates for early stages of the project life cycle.
  • Creating design drawings utilizing Revit 3D design software.
  • Conducting or participating in investigative energy assessments to identify energy and cost savings measures.
  • Assessing and designing building ventilation systems based on requirements for heat removal in industrial spaces and maintaining indoor air quality.
  • Conducting spreadsheet analysis to assess the energy and cost savings of proposed energy conservation measures (ECMs)
  • Utilizing building modeling software (HAP or Trane Trace) to determine envelope heat gains/losses and assess savings potentials of ECMs.
  • Specifying mechanical equipment
  • Designing plumbing and building utility piping systems
  • Summarizing engineering results in written reports and/or presentations that are cohesive and of the highest quality.
  • Visiting job sites as required for projects involving upfit of existing systems.  A mix of day trips and overnight domestic trips should be expected.
  • Adhering to the policies and standards set forth in the Ramboll’s Project Execution Manual.
  • Promoting and maintaining a safe working environment for all employees by adhering to Ramboll’s Health, Safety, and Environmental procedures.

Skills & Qualifications:

  • B.S. in Mechanical Engineering or greater
  • 5+ years of experience in engineering and design of HVAC systems
  • Licensed professional engineer strongly preferred
  • Ability to foster a creative engineering environment
  • Strong communication skills, (both in written and verbal)
  • Ability to work across a wide range of areas within the mechanical engineering discipline
  • Strong computer skills in the Microsoft Office suite of programs
  • Experience with AutoCAD and Revit design software preferred

Salary Transparency Statement

At Ramboll, your base pay is only part of your overall total compensation package. At the time of this posting, this role is likely to be compensated at an annual rate between $79,000. And $100.000. Actual pay may be more or less than the posted range, depending on numerous factors, including experience, geographical location, internal equity, market conditions, education/training and skill level, and does not include bonuses, overtime, or other forms of compensation or benefits.
